Used equipment:
Microphones:
Main system: Schoeps MK5 AB
Spot mic's: Neumann KM84, Neumann TLM170, Neumann U47, Van Medevoort C1000
Micpre's: RME Micstacy (Analog > MADI)
Microphone cables: Grimm Audio TPR
Master clock: Grimm Audio CC1
Mixing headphones: Sennheiser HD800
Mixing speakers: Grimm Audio LS1
Recording and mixing - Frans de Rond
